Compared with that of creatinine, plasma concentrations … WebJul 1, 2024 · Serum creatinine is used as a marker to evaluate kidney function and estimate glomerular filtration rate because of its complete filtration by the kidney. 1,2 However, there are disadvantages to using creatinine as an indicator of kidney function. Serum creatinine levels can be influenced by age, sex, muscle mass, diet, and chronic …

We investigated the association of … WebSep 18, 2024 · So sometimes we’ll see in older patients the creatinine suggests the kidney function is over 100, but in fact the eGFR is only 40 with cystatin C. The tests can be dramatically different because older or sicker people often aren’t making any creatinine.” In contrast, the cystatin C test provides an unbiased estimate of kidney function.
